Jasmine N.

The Border Benedict is my jam. Sometimes the meat is a bit dry and not super flavorful, but the sauce with the sweet corn cake and all the other flavors are so good. They also have mimosa and Bloody Mary flights, which I loved because I always want to try everything. Their menu is definitely a bit overwhelming. When I couldn't decide, our server let us know we could mix and match Benedict's! That's awesome! I decided to mix and match and got one border and one sope Benedict. They were both delicious, but the border Benedict is still my favorite. Our server also offered us free reusable tote bags! I recently tried their takeout, which held up well! Of course I got the Border Benedict and my friend got the waffle. The Border Benedict was delicious as usual, but I wasn't happy they didn't let us know there was no butter or syrup in the bag for the waffle. They didn't ask me what kind of potatoes when I ordered over the phone, and i ended up with hashbrowns. The homefries are better. This place can get packed, so I try not to go during busy times, and make sure you check your order and ask for any condiments before you go!

Anthony F.

The Broken Yolk is one of our favorite breakfast chains. This spot didn't disappoint. The place isn't hard to find and there's plenty of parking. The inside is roomy and we were pleasantly surprised to see holiday-themed decor. You can argue about pulling out the Christmas tree before Thanksgiving, but it was nice. We came on a weekday around noon and it wasn't busy. We were seated and served promptly, with hot coffees and water brought out right away. I ordered a meat lover's skillet, which had ham, sausages, peppers and thinly sliced potatoes with three eggs on top, I ordered mine over easy, and opened them up so the yolk could mix into the rest of the food. The skillet didn't look as big as I had hoped, but it was plenty filling. My +1 ordered a salmon eggs Benedict, which was tender and delicious. The capers went well with the salmon and the hollandaise sauce brought it all together. They also have kid's options, and our little one must be in the middle of a growth spurt because he's constantly hungry. The generous portion of pancakes, along with a scrambled egg and two pieces of bacon, were enough to satisfy him. For the time being. Overall, the food was great, service was great, and we left satisfied.

Ask the Community - Broken Yolk Cafe

Do they charge a fee for using a credit card?

Hello, We do not charge a fee for credit cards.

Does broken yoke have tables and chairs or just booths?

We have a variety of seating available! Booths, tables, and chairs are all seating options.

Do you guys have real maple syrup?

Hi Ryan, Our syrup is a standard breakfast syrup that does have some maple but is not 100% pure maple syrup.
